X-Git-Url: https://www.fleuret.org/cgi-bin/gitweb/gitweb.cgi?p=mappings.git;a=blobdiff_plain;f=mappings.cc;h=12efeca882863f05f325ce4bfba1661843526f7c;hp=236ae156880e2817adf8a50b6f0717343ca29f8b;hb=HEAD;hpb=ba03470cb64a7e8f858502ec3c7be75e3626e618 diff --git a/mappings.cc b/mappings.cc index 236ae15..12efeca 100644 --- a/mappings.cc +++ b/mappings.cc @@ -33,7 +33,7 @@ int nb_refs = 0; // have grab() or release() out of constructors / destructors and // assignement operator. -// With such a politic, you should not need to worry about references +// With such a policy, you should not need to worry about references // anywhere else class Map { @@ -177,7 +177,7 @@ Mapping &Mapping::operator = (const Mapping &m) { } float Mapping::operator () (float x) const { return f->eval(x); } -Mapping Mapping::derivative() const { return Mapping(f->derivative()); }; +Mapping Mapping::derivative() const { return Mapping(f->derivative()); } Mapping Mapping::compose(const Mapping &m) const { return Mapping(f->compose(m.f)); } Mapping Mapping::add(const Mapping &m) const { return Mapping(new Sum(f, m.f)); }